Vote Share Trends: Clear Lead for LDF

According to AI projections (April 6, 2026):

  • LDF: 45.23%
  • UDF: 33.30%
  • NDA: 21.48%
Key Observations
  • LDF leads by nearly 12 percentage points
  • NDA holds a significant vote share that could influence margins
  • UDF trails as the secondary political force
